Indonesia Incorporates Nuclear Energy into Decarbonization and Power Planning
The National Energy Council (DEN) of Indonesia recently stated that nuclear energy is expected to become an important option for driving the country's energy transition and achieving its net-zero emission targets. DEN member Sripeni Inten Cahyani said at a national energy policy promotion event held at Mataram University that the positioning of nuclear energy in Indonesia's energy planning is changing, and it is no longer just a last resort.
